Key Considerations Before Buying
- Size and Expandability: At 24 inches, this suitcase fits within most airline checked luggage limits, but the expandable feature adds extra packing capacity. Ensure the expanded dimensions still comply with your carrier's size restrictions to avoid fees.
- Material and Durability: The ABS hard shell provides impact resistance and a sleek appearance, but it may be less flexible than polycarbonate. Check for reinforced corners and a sturdy handle, as these are common stress points in checked luggage.
- Mobility and Maneuverability: Spinner wheels offer smooth rolling on flat surfaces, but consider the wheel quality and bearing type. The NEWBULIG's wheels should handle airport corridors and sidewalks without wobbling, especially when fully packed.

Common Issues
Common problems in this category include wheel breakage after a few trips, zipper failures on expandable sections, and scratches or cracks on ABS shells. Additionally, some suitcases may tip over when fully loaded due to wheel placement, and telescopic handles can jam if not reinforced.
Quality Indicators
Quality indicators include double-stitched zippers, smooth-rolling bearings on wheels, and a warranty of at least 2-3 years.
